Jones takes the helm as PPRI’s new director

Long-time employee Amy Jones has been named executive director of the Prairie Plains Resource Institute, stepping into her new role Oct. 4. “The board is very excited to have Amy Jones take on the executive director role for PPRI,” said board president Brad Bangs.
